Can we talk about eating?

First, this is not a post complaining about weight gain, which I could honestly care less about.  I wish I was gaining more actually, as I'm still up under 20.  But I feel like I literally can't eat enough during waking hours.  I have three meals before lunch (eggs, toast, yogurt, cereal, fruit, etc.) and then it's pretty much eat eat from there on.  I think the kids are having a growth spurt and I'm feeling hungry all the time, and I am not exerting myself physically at all.

Do you ever feel like this?  Have you tried Ensure or some other supplemental calorie delivery system?  How do you stay satisfied?  I fear that if we had a pet, they would be in danger...  Embarrassed

I/DH make healthy smoothies between snacks and meals as I figured they are really calorie dense, but I'm looking for any ideas you might have to share.  I'm drinking mostly water now and eating as clean as possible (whole) foods (incl lots of cheese and peanut butter).

    sounds like you are doing really well with your eating!

    i have definitely had spurts where i cannot be satisfied. even now, i need to eat something prolly every 1 1/2 to 2 hours or i'm starving. my H and i call it "feeding the beasts" :)

    do you drink a lot of milk? dr luke recommends a quart a day. i think i've done that on a handful of days, but i do try to drink 3 glass a day and it helps fill me up.

    this is what i eat, not the exact same thing every day, but a good representation of what helps keep me satisfied:

    slice whole wheat banana bread and a glass of milk

    pb&j on whole wheat toast and orange juice

    either a bowl of cereal with a cup of milk or a bowl of cottage cheese with fruit

    lunch - it depends, usually it's just leftovers. but it almost always has meat in it for protein, plus a veg

    handful of almonds or 2 hardboiled eggs with mayo

    cup of greek yogurt with fruit, a lean cuisine snack (the egg rolls are SO GOOD and aren't terrible in terms of ingredients or sodium and they have a good amt of protein) or on a bad day a few cookies with a glass of milk

    serving of fruit

    dinner, which is some kind of meat with pasta or rice and a veg

    dessert of some sort, or if i don't think i've eaten enough that day i make a smoothie with a banana, frozen strawberries, milk, greek yogurt, flax oil and wheat germ.

    ETA - as of last week i am up 49 pounds.

    I ate big bowls of fiber cereal like Kashi.  It's low cal, high protein but bulky.  So it physically fills your stomach more, plus the fiber helps the old bum.  I found that the bulk kept me full longer then high calorie but smaller sized foods did.

    With the twins, eat what you can now because around 25-27 weeks I have gotten full within minutes.  

    I love the glucerna shakes (low sugar) and I also do smoothies as well, but with added protein powder.  In addition, I think it's good to snack all day.  With multiples-- you have to.  Get tons of protein and calcium.
